PDP Confirms Aziegbemi-Led Caretaker Committee Remains in Control in Edo

February 13, 2025
in News
Reading Time: 1 min read

The National Working Committee (NWC) of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) said on Thursday the caretaker committee led by Dr. Tony Aziegbemi remains the leader of the party in Edo State.

The party’s National Publicity Secretary, Debo Ologunagba, disclosed this in a statement on Thursday in Abuja.

He said the attention of the PDP national leadership had been drawn to activities of certain individuals parading themselves as the party’s executives in Edo Chapter of the PDP.

The spokesman said: “The PDP states in clear terms that the Edo State Chapter is presently being run by a 10-member Caretaker Committee with Aziegbemi as Chairman and Henry Tenebe as Secretary.”

Ologunagba said that the caretaker committee was duly appointed by the NWC.

He listed the members of the committee to include Harrison Omagbon, Fidel Igenegbale, Chris Nehikhare, Tony Anenih Jnr., Bishop Anthony Okosun, Segun Saiki, Adezat Ibrahim, and Augustine Edosomwan.

“The PDP cautions that any other persons illegally parading themselves as the PDP executive in Edo State will be treated as impostors as the Party has not elected a new Exco for the Edo State Chapter.

“Moreover the arty will not hesitate to take decisive disciplinary action against any person acting in defiance of the clear provisions of the Constitution of the PDP (as amended in 2017),’’ he added.
